An Everliving Warrior

A poem by Aaromal P Ajith, Son of Prathibha V, Roll no 2889 and Ajith P Anand, Roll no 2787

With the shimmering star on his heart he realizes,
That life and death isn't just a game.
With hardened mind, he walks in valiant grace,
Knowing the debt he must fulfill.

The three colours of their mother soaring high,
Imprinting an emotion to these worthy souls.
Defiant to foe, amiable to allies,
Shaping a world for the alluring freedom.

Captain Harshan treads on the trail,
Savouring the moments of his moulding soul.
With unwavering spirit of nation held tight,
He walks through a phase where memories are life.

Living through a time where even silence speaks,
Sacrificing his life and a soulmate he never met.
Flying off to a land, away from his life-givers,
Empowered by no sword, but living words.

Acknowledging a life, refrained by some,
Uncovering the rival's vicious deeds,
He soared in his life through his conduct.
In military, a man whom even time admires.

His tale succumbs in Baramulla;
The eminent martyr who awakened history.
His last mission, where he eliminated two,
Changed the fate of this young soul.

Never accepted death, even when shot twice.
Off a grenade rose from his cold hands,
Marking its trail like a rainbow, black and white.
It marks the end of the heroic warrior.

His life, plain to others,
Filled with points that ought to be noted.
A loss, irreparable to our nation,
But leaving an energy radiating through future.

Acknowledging his feat, came nation's reply:
'Ashoka Chakra' will adorn his soul.
Accepting the recognition for his son's valour,
His teardrop gleamed in the 'Ashoka Chakra'.

A glittering image in the face of history.
A shimmering life that the nation received.
A boon that withered just before blooming.
Bravery, thy name is Harshan!
